What Does the Diabetes Drug Byetta and the Gila Monster Have in Common with Causes Weight Loss?
There are many people with Type 2 Diabetes that currently utilize the drug Byetta marketed by Eli Lilly and Amylin. The active ingredient in Byetta is a synthetic version of a protein produced in the saliva of the Gila Monster. Insulin Pump Breakthrough:The Nanopump
Up until now the smallest insulin pumps available have been about the size of a pager. Now, thanks to the new Nanopump created by Debiotech there will be just 25% of that size on the market.
